Incorporating a Procedure Into an Application
When you create a procedure in the current project,
it is automatically incorporated into that project. However, you
are not limited to the use of procedures created in the project.
You can make procedures from another project available in the current project.
To incorporate a procedure from another project into the current
project, complete the following steps:
- Add the directory
of the procedure to the project path. When you add the directory
of a procedure to the project path, all project files become available.
For details on modifying available directories for a project, see How to Modify Directory Paths.
- Add a procedure
to the project. Once the directory of the procedure is visible to
a project, add the procedure to the project so it will be available
for reporting and deployment. For details, see How to Add a Procedure to a Project.
Note: You can also remove a procedure from a project.
For details, see How to Remove a Procedure From a Project.

Procedure: How to Add a Procedure to a Project
-
Open
the Procedures folder in the project.
-
If not
already selected, click the Displays all files in the project
path button on the Explorer toolbar.
The right window pane displays all procedures in the paths
defined for the selected project. Procedures that are not added
to the project path have a light gray icon next to them, and the
file type description is FOCUS Executable Visible within Project
Path.
-
Do one
of the following:
- Right-click
a procedure from the available procedures on the right, and select Add
to Project from the shortcut menu.
or
- Select a procedure
and click the Inserts the selected items into the project button on
the Explorer toolbar.
The procedure icon changes color
to signify that it has been added to the project, and the file type
changes to FOCUS Executable.
Tip: Clicking
the Displays all files in the project path button on
the Explorer toolbar toggles between the files that are visible
in the project path and the files that have been added to the project.

Procedure: How to Remove a Procedure From a Project
-
Open
the Procedures folder in the project.
-
If not
already selected, click the Displays all files in the project
path button on
the Explorer toolbar.
The right window pane displays all procedures in the paths
defined for the selected project. Procedures that have been added
to the project path have a color icon next to them, and the file
type description is FOCUS Executable.
-
Do one
of the following:
- In the right
window pane, right-click a procedure and choose Remove
from Project from the pop-up menu.
or
- Select a procedure
and click the Delete button on the
Explorer toolbar.
-
Click Yes to
confirm permanent removal of the procedure.
